Exploring Nusa Penida: A Tropical Escape

Saturday, September 16: Arrival and Relaxation

Welcome to Nusa Penida! After arriving at the Nusa Penida Port, head to your hotel to check-in and freshen up. Spend the morning relaxing and soaking up the tranquility of the island. In the afternoon, venture to Crystal Bay, a picturesque beach known for its crystal-clear waters and vibrant marine life. Take a dip in the refreshing sea or simply unwind on the white sandy shore. As the evening approaches, savor a delicious seafood dinner at one of the local beachfront restaurants.

  • Crystal Bay: Cost - Free, Time Spent - 3-4 hours

Sunday, September 17: Island Exploration

Embark on a thrilling island exploration adventure today. Start your day with a visit to Kelingking Beach, also known as T-Rex Beach due to its unique rock formation resembling a dinosaur. Enjoy breathtaking views of the turquoise ocean from the cliff's edge. Afterward, make your way to Broken Beach, a natural rock arch surrounded by crashing waves. Take in the dramatic scenery and capture stunning photos. Continue your journey to Angel's Billabong, a natural infinity pool where you can swim and admire the natural beauty.

  • Kelingking Beach: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Broken Beach: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Angel's Billabong: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ours

Monday, September 18: Cultural Immersion

Immerse yourself in the rich cultural heritage of Nusa Penida today. Begin your morning with a visit to Goa Giri Putri, a sacred cave temple nestled in a limestone hill. Explore the mystical chambers and witness the Hindu rituals performed by locals. Next, head to the beautiful Atuh Beach, known for its stunning cliffs and crystal-clear waters. Relax on the sandy shore or take a leisurely swim. In the evening, enjoy a traditional Balinese dance performance, showcasing the island's vibrant culture.

  • Goa Giri Putri: Cost - 20,000 IDR (approx. $1.50),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Atuh Beach: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Balinese Dance Performance: Cost - 100,000 IDR (approx. $7), Time Spent - 1-2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For those seeking off the beaten path attractions, explore Peguyangan Waterfall. This hidden gem features a series of cascading waterfalls surrounded by steep cliffs, offering a unique and refreshing experience. Another local favorite is the Banah Cliffs, where you can witness mesmerizing views of the ocean and rugged coastline. Don't forget to try the local specialty, Nasi Campur, a mixed rice dish with various flavors and spices.
